YetepScottish producer Grum just released his latest single, entitled “Don’t Look Down.” A progressive house track with sweeping vocals from Natalie Shay, “Don’t Look Down” is the second single off the producer’s forthcoming album, Unreality, set to release on June 24th.

Grum last worked with Shay on “Stay,” featured on Groom’s 2019 Deep State album. Unreality will be the producer’s fourth artist album, and most personal project to date. Here’s what he had to say about the latest single:
“This is about remembering our humanity, which perhaps we lost a little bit over the last couple of years. Maybe we can get a bit of it back in the dark, under some strobe lights. It just felt right to kick off this album with a track with Natalie. It started as a little melody progression which i sent over to her. [She] came back with this vocal that helped turn it into an 80’s stadium, heart inspired, monster.”
